Today we traveled to the medival hilltown of Orvieto. Orvieto is in the Umbria region of Italy. It overlooks vineyards and villages and small towns.
There is one main road with many stores. At the top of the hill is the main attaction, the Duomo of Orvieto. It is a cathedral with Italian Gothic architecture! The facade is very beautiful!
